The first major Bradlees store closings came in 1988, when it exited the Southern United States. Bradlees remained profitable into the early 1990s. In 1992, a year after its parent company becoming public once again, Stop & Shop Inc. sold Bradlees to an investment group, and the chain continued as a separate company.

Supplemental Security Income (SSI) payments can’t be garnished or levied. One thing to keep in mind is that there are limits on how much of your Social Security payment can be garnished.
